Perfect Square
298117572289884037781749202859479704738778629873520841 is a perfect square (546001439824002696541216221 × 546001439824002696541216221)
298117572289884037781749202859479704738778629873520841 is a perfect square (546001439824002696541216221 × 546001439824002696541216221)
298117572289884037781749202859479704738778629873520841 is odd
Previous odd number is 298117572289884037781749202859479704738778629873520839
Next odd number is 298117572289884037781749202859479704738778629873520843
1100011100110011000101001000000111100111100010101000000010101010101101000010011010010010110110010000101111100101110110001011111010011101110010000101010100101000101101000011001001
26494927028497370274762107114796979189278696804183595487780786622029066932235314299041074770567267924287951022370672818062146383206035749422132353066099092183321
88874086908014235094135431899457692824010815996683711142943133159844883560470127678818828396852637661347281
143463051007474250025255023222662057456613723562052450550311